The purpose of the study was finding out the demotivating factors on the 2nd grade students’ speaking skill based on the students and teachers’ perception in SMA Negeri 1 Seririt. The study was a descriptive research. The method of the study was survey. In order to collect the data required, questionnaire was used as a means of collecting data both from the students and teachers. Therefore, the questionnaire was differentiated into student’ questionnaire and teacher’ questionnaire. As a result, the study showed that the students identified three out of nine factors suggested by Dornyei (2001) cited in Jomairi (2011) as demotivating factors on their speaking skill. In addition, the students conveyed nine additional demotivating factors based on their own perception. Besides that, the study showed that the teachers identified two out of nine factors suggested by Dornyei (2001) cited in Jomairi (2011) as demotivating factors on the students’ speaking skill. Furthermore, the teachers conveyed four additional demotivating factors based on their experiences in the classroom.
